Les Eclaireurs Lighthouse
The Les Eclaireurs Lighthouse guards the city of Ushuaia in Argentina, and shouldn’t be confused for the San Juan de Salvamento light nearby. This light is still in operation but is remote controlled and automated, but it still remains a popular tourist location.

Southern Fuegian Railway, Ushuaia, Argentina: The Southern Fuegian Railway or the Train of the End of the World is a 500 mm gauge steam railway in Tierra del Fuego Province, Argentina. It was originally built as a freight line to serve the prison of Ushuaia, specifically to transport timber. It now operates as a heritage railway into the Tierra del Fuego National Park and is considered the southernmost functioning railway in the world. Wikipedia
